Texas A&M is in uncharted territory.

Only one other time during coach Kevin Sumlin’s tenure has Texas A&M lost back-to-back games, but the Aggies are officially on a losing streak thanks to the state of Mississippi.

Saturday’s 35-20 loss to Ole Miss meant the Aggies had been outscored 83-51 in its last two games against the Rebels and Mississippi State. It’s been a shocking turn of events because prior to these losses, many were expecting the Aggies to compete for the SEC West title, especially after they started so strong against South Carolina. However, with two losses and Mississippi State and Ole Miss surging, it would be tough for A&M to get back into the race.

And really, it only has itself to blame.

Quarterback Kenny Hill had two interceptions, including a pick-six, on Saturday and also had a fumble that led to a score. The turnover problems started creeping up last week when Hill threw three interceptions.

Take out the turnovers against Ole Miss and it’s a different story. Texas A&M had more total yards and a longer time of possession. But it also had more penalties and Ole Miss never lost the ball.

Now the Aggies head to Tuscaloosa to take on an Alabama team that’s had its own issues of late. This is actually a game Texas A&M could steal if it could just secure the ball. Alabama’s defense is playing well, but the rest of its team has been suspect.

If A&M can’t get out of its own way again, the Aggies will embark on their first three-game losing streak in Sumlin time in College Station, which is something no one expected when the season began with so much promise.
